Abstract
An antenna device is disclosed for making the three-dimensional electromagnetic field available. In a complete system the antenna device will be connected to standard radio equipment such as transceivers, etc, which will allow the antenna signals to be processed. The unique polarization information from the antenna device enables the signal to be processed in order to cancel fading, minimize co-channel interference, determine angle of arrival, perform beam-forming etc. Thus, it is the combination of the antenna device together with custom-built signal processing algorithms which gives the full utility of the invention. In a general form an antenna array is built up by at least two polarization cells (5), each comprising a pair of crossed dipoles (20) for a first and second direction of polarization and a monopole element (25) for a third direction of polarization, a number of polarization cells forming an array column. Every second polarization cell (10) may be turned by 180 degrees. A feeding system (90) with proper interconnections of the polarization cells creates a means for selecting signals of three different polarization directions to thereby making available three-dimensional electromagnetic field information of a present radio frequency wave.
